首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    使用Pytorch和BERT进行多标签文本分类

    为简便起见,我已展示了如何对单词计数列进行计数,其中单个标题中使用的总单词数将被计算在内。您可能还需要处理类似于TITLE的Abstract列,以及ABSTRACT和TITLE的组合。...同时,设置将用于模型训练的参数。由于我更喜欢使用2*base数字,因此最大长度设置为16,这涵盖了大部分“ TITLE”长度。训练和有效批处理大小设置为32。...epoch为4,因为它很容易在几个epoch上过度拟合。我从lr=0.00001开始学习。您可以随意尝试不同的值以提高准确性。...它期望具有上面定义的“ TITLE”,“ target_list”,max_len,并使用BERT toknizer.encode_plus函数将输入设置为数字矢量格式,然后转换为张量格式返回。...模型预测的准确率为76%。F1得分低的原因是有六个类的预测,通过结合“TITLE”和“ABSTRACT”或者只使用“ABSTRACT”来训练可以提高它。

    6.7K53

    使用BERT和TensorFlow构建多标签文本分类器

    例如: 文本可能同时涉及任何宗教,政治,金融或教育,也可能不属于任何一种。 电影可以根据其摘要内容分为动作,喜剧和浪漫类型。有可能电影属于romcoms [浪漫与喜剧]等多种类型。...然而,BERT表示“ bank ”同时使用它的前面和后面的背景- “ I accessed the … account ” - 从深层神经网络的最底层开始,使其成为双向的。...在本文中将重点介绍BERT在多标签文本分类问题中的应用。因此将基本上修改示例代码并应用必要的更改以使其适用于多标签方案。 建立 使用安装BERT !...标记化 标记化涉及将输入文本分解为单个单词。为此,第一步是创建tokenizer对象。...create_examples(),读取数据框并将输入文本和相应的目标标签加载到InputExample 对象中。

    11K41

    使用Jupyter和Prodigy发现文本分类中的错误标签

    使用Jupyter和Prodigy发现文本分类中的错误标签Prodigy是由spaCy开发团队打造的现代化数据标注工具,专门用于收集机器学习模型的训练数据。...本视频将展示如何设置Prodigy来发现文本分类任务中的错误标签。虽然这些技术主要应用于文本分类,但它们同样适用于一般的分类任务。...43)Jupyter进阶操作 (25:38)怀疑原因分析 (29:29)Prodigy环境设置 (31:20)Prodigy标注实践 (32:56)标注者分歧处理 (38:01)经验总结 (42:16)...技术资源Prodigy官方网站和文档谷歌情绪研究论文Whatlies嵌入可视化项目Doubtlab可疑标签检测库技术要点通过结合Jupyter Notebook的灵活性和Prodigy的专业标注功能,可以系统性地识别和修正训练数据中的错误标签...,提升文本分类模型的准确性和可靠性。

    9810

    该死的“值标签”-如何使用SPSS画频率分布图和直方图

    这里总结一下这类题型的做法(以组距为3为例) 方法一:使用Record(重新编码)过程(不推荐) 转换-->重新编码为不同变量 把25-28重新分组到25; 把28-31重新分组到28; ……设置到手酸...然后对刚才那一组进行描述统计分析,得到频率分布图和直方图。...方法二:使用图形编辑 先用描述统计做图。 然后双击直方图横轴任意一个数字, 即可更改最小值,最大值以及组距。...方法三:使用可视化分箱 (Visual Bander)等距分组 转换-->可视化分箱 生成分割点-->输入等宽区间-->生成标签 生成标签后,SPSS会自动根据这个范围进行分组。...【如果点击确定出现的下面这种数字怎么办】 解决办法:查看-->勾选值标签即可 【注】 这里的直方图做出来的直方图并不是频率分布直方图,因为频率分布直方图的纵轴必须是频率除以组距,而SPSS做出来的直方图的纵轴是频数

    1.2K10

    与Ajax同样重要的jQuery(1)

    :parent 选取含有子元素或文本节点的元素 $("td:parent") 所有不为空td元素选中 练习4: ² 设置含有文本内容 ”传智播客” 的 div 的字体颜色为红色 ² 设置没有子元素的div...添加 class属性,值为itcast ² 设置table所有 可见 tr 背景色 黄色 ² 设置table所有 隐藏tr 字体颜色为红色,显示出来 ,并输出tr中文本值 值为itcast $("input:hidden").addClass("itcast"); // 设置table所有 可见 tr 背景色 黄色 $("tr:visible").css("background-color...","yellow"); // 设置table所有 隐藏tr 字体颜色为红色,显示出来 ,并输出tr中文本值 $("tr:hidden").each(function(){ alert($(this)....⑧:表单过滤选择器 选取表单元素的过滤选择器 :input 选取所有input>、、和元素 :text 选取所有的文本框元素 :password

    11.5K60

    javaWeb核心技术第五篇之jQuery

    (写的更少,做的更多) - jQuery入门 - jQuery和html整合 - 下载 - 下载地址:www.jquery.com - 使用script的src属性即可...= $("选择器"); $("#id值"); val();" - javaScript和jquery区别 - 注意事项: "使用jquery的方式获取的对象称为...jquery对象, 使用js的方式获取的对象称为dom(js)对象, 两者的方法和属性不能混用, 使用jquery的方法和属性时,必须保证对象是jquery对象...jQuery和html整合: 1.下载 2.通过script标签的src属性引入即可(1.11) jQuery语法: $("选择器"); 或 jQuery("选择器"); jq对象和...和text区别 "设置内容: html可以将内容解析,text只是作为普通文本 获取内容:html获取所有源码内容,text只是获取文本内容" - 文档处理 - 内部插入

    9K10

    jQuery

    方法括号内没有值就获取,有值就设置 HTML代码 html()// 取得第一个匹配元素的html内容 html(val)// 设置所有匹配元素的html内容 文本值 text()// 取得所有匹配元素的内容...返回第一个匹配元素的属性值 DOM:setAttribute(name,value) attr(attrName, attrValue)// 为所有匹配元素设置一个属性值 attr({k1:...v1, k2:v2})// 为所有匹配元素设置多个属性值 removeAttr()// 从每一个匹配的元素中删除一个属性 用于checkbox和radio prop() // 获取属性 removeProp...attr 对于返回布尔值的比如checkbox、radio和option的是否被选中都用prop 通俗理解为:attr适用于属性为静态的情况(不经常修改动态变化的),而prop用于动态变化的情况,尤其是选择类标签...jQuery库的话直接使用on同时绑定这两个事件即可。

    8.2K10

    day40_jQuery学习笔记_01

    、使用Ajax以及其他功能 jQuery能够使用户的html页面保持代码和html内容分离 不用再在html里面插入一堆js来调用命令了,只需要定义id即可 jQuery提供API让开发者编写插件,有许多成熟的插件可供选择...,就设置value的值为默认值,否则不设置。...获得value的值 val(text)   设置value的值 html()      获得html代码,含有标签,即获得标签+文本 html(...)   ...设置html代码,如果有标签,将被解析 text()      获得文本值,将标签进行过滤,即只获得文本 text(...)   ...设置文本值,如果有标签,将被转义,即:为 <     & 转义为 &      > 转义为 <       空格 转义为   4.4、CSS 详解如下: 指的是

    7.2K20

    WEB入门之十五 属性和样式

    本章将学习如何使用jQuery进行标签属性和CSS样式操作,jQuery提供了大量的函数来帮助开发人员简化对标签属性和CSS样式的操作。...( ) 设置元素class属性的值 removeClass ( ) 删除元素class属性的值 6.1.1 html()、val()和text() html()和val()是前面已经讲过并且经常使用的属性函数...6.1.1 addClass和removeClass addClass和removeClass都是针对标签的class属性进行操作的函数,class属性用来设置标签的类样式,值为某个类样式的名字。...)+"\n");document.write("是否为数字:"+$.isNumeric(val));}) 上述代码使用type和isNumeric函数对文本框的值进行了检测...本章将学习如何使用jQuery进行标签属性和CSS样式操作,jQuery提供了大量的函数来帮助开发人员简化对标签属性和CSS样式的操作。

    51010

    jQuery

    ,是标签和标签之间的距离 outerWidth() 文本操作     HTML代码: html()// 取得第一个匹配元素的html内容,包含标签内容 html(val)// 设置所有匹配元素的html...内容,识别标签,能够表现出标签的效果     文本值: text()// 取得所有匹配元素的内容,只有文本内容,没有标签 text(val)// 设置所有匹配元素的内容,不识别标签,将标签作为文本插入进去...attr(attrName, attrValue)// 为所有匹配元素设置一个属性值 attr({k1: v1, k2:v2})// 为所有匹配元素设置多个属性值 removeAttr()// 从每一个匹配的元素中删除一个属性...jQuery库的话直接使用on同时绑定这两个事件即可。...标签里面的值为空就组织它提交,就可以使用这两种方法 2. e.stopPropagation(); <!

    10.2K20

    Web-第四天 jQuery学习

    =值] 获得属性名 不等于 值 元素。 [...][...][...] 复合属性选择器,多个属性同时过滤。...attr() 设置标签属性 removeAttr() 移除标签的属性。 注意:prop() 和 attr() 使用时容易混淆,建议先使用prop() 没有效果,再使用attr()。...基础入门2 今日内容介绍 重写javascript案例:省市联动 重写javascript案例:左右选择 重写javascript案例:表单校验 今日内容学习目标 能够使用jQuery为标签添加属性或样式...val() 获得value属性的值 val(...) 给value属性设置值 html() 获得html代码,如果有标签,一并获得。 html(....) 设置html代码,如果有标签,将进行解析。...text() 获得文本,如果有标签,忽略。 text(....) 设置文本,如果含有标签,不进行解析。原样输出。

    4.3K40
    领券